How This Service Actually Works

Basement water removal is not a one-size-fits-all process. The right approach depends on the amount of water, the type of damage, and how quickly you act. Skipping steps or using the wrong tools can lead to mold, structural issues, and even more expensive repairs. Our team has the training and equipment to handle every situation. Assessment and Planning

Our technicians start by evaluating the damage. They check for standing water, identify the source, and plan the removal process. This step helps find out the right tools and how long the job will take. You’ll get a clear picture of what’s needed and why. We use moisture meters and thermal imaging to spot hidden issues. Water Extraction

We use powerful pumps and wet vacuums to remove standing water as quickly as possible. The faster we act, the better the outcome. This step typically takes 1-3 hours depending on the size of the area. We’ll remove all visible water and start the drying process. Drying and Dehumidification

After the water is out, we bring in industrial dryers and dehumidifiers. These machines work around the clock to remove moisture from the air and surfaces. This step can take 3-5 days. We monitor the progress constantly to make sure everything is drying properly. No area is left unchecked. We use tools like hygrometers to track humidity levels. Warning Signs You Need Basement Water Removal

Early detection is key with basement water damage. Ignoring these signs can lead to serious issues. The longer you wait, the more damage can occur. You need to act quickly if you notice any of these warning signs. Recognizing them can save you money and prevent bigger problems down the road.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A damp, moldy smell in your basement is a sign of moisture buildup. It means water is lingering and could lead to mold growth. This odor is not something to ignore. It can affect your health and the structure of your home. You should address it as soon as possible. The longer you wait, the harder it is to fix.

Water Stains or Warped Surfaces

Dark stains on walls or floors are a clear sign of water damage. Warped wood or peeling paint also show moisture issues. These signs can appear even if the water has dried. They show that water has been present and could cause long-term damage. You need to get this checked out immediately. The damage might be more extensive than it looks.

Standing Water After Rain

If your basement has standing water after a storm, that’s a red flag. It shows that your drainage system isn’t working properly. Water can seep in through cracks or poor grading. This issue can get worse over time. You need to fix the source of the water. Ignoring it can lead to more expensive repairs and safety hazards.

Cracks in the Foundation

Small cracks in your basement walls or floor can let water in. They might seem harmless at first, but they can grow over time. Water can enter through these gaps and cause damage. You should have them inspected and repaired as soon as possible. Even a small crack can lead to major problems if left untreated.

High Humidity Levels

If your basement feels unusually humid, that’s a sign of moisture issues. High humidity can lead to mold and mildew growth. It can also make your home feel uncomfortable. You should check the humidity levels regularly. If it’s consistently high, you need to address the source of the moisture. This could be a hidden leak or a drainage problem.

Wet or Muddy Ground Around the Foundation

If the ground around your home is wet or muddy, that could mean water is pooling near your basement. This can lead to water seeping in through the walls or floor. You should check the grading around your home. If it’s not sloping away from the foundation, water can collect and cause damage. Fixing this issue can prevent future problems.

Basement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Minor dampness in a small area Yes No It’s manageable with basic tools but not a permanent fix.
Standing water over 2 inches deep No Yes It needs professional equipment and expertise to remove safely.
Mold already growing in the basement No Yes Mold needs to be removed by professionals to prevent health issues.
Water from a broken pipe or flooding No Yes This is a high-risk situation that needs immediate attention.
Water damage has been ignored for weeks No Yes Extended exposure leads to structural and health risks that need expert help.
Water damage in a finished basement No Yes Protecting furniture and personal items needs specialized care.

Calling a professional is the best choice when the damage is more than just a small issue. You can handle minor dampness on your own, but larger problems need the right tools and knowledge. Basement Water Removal Cost In Elon, NC

Costs for basement water removal vary based on the severity of the damage, the size of the area affected, and the type of water involved. These are general estimates and can change depending on your specific situation. You should always get a detailed quote before any work begins. The right team will give you a clear breakdown of what you can expect.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 The amount of water and the type of flooring affect the cost.
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000 – $4,000 The size of the area and how long it takes to dry find out the price.
Mold Removal $750 – $3,500 Severity of the mold and the surfaces affected impact the cost.
Structural Repairs $500 – $2,000 Damage to walls, floors, or ceilings increases the cost.
Sanitization $300 – $1,200 The extent of contamination and the need for special treatments affect the price.
Final Inspection and Cleanup $200 – $800 More work required after the main repair can add to the cost.

How can I prevent basement water damage?

Maintaining your drainage system and checking for cracks in the foundation are key. Regular inspections can help catch issues early. You should also make sure your gutters and downspouts are working properly. These steps can prevent water from entering your basement in the first place.
